Full Job Description

The post holder will perform specialised clinical neurophysiological procedures to a high standard, advanced analysis of test results, report on outcomes and advised clinicians as required.

To deputise for the Head of Department as and when required. Must be able to work unsupervised.

Main duties of the job

Independently perform digital EEG's with video recordings on patients with routine monitoring of EEG plus activation procedures if not contra-indicated.

Perform EEG recordings to a consistently high level and with appropriate amendments as required, on neonates, paediatrics and patients of all ages and with additional needs.

Carry out highly specialised portable EEG recordings on Wards/Intensive Care/High-Dependency Unit.

In-depth analysis of ambulatory EEG, annotating and pruning relevant sections for consultant review as required.

Competent and confident in providing provisional reports on investigations if clinically urgent and appropriate - both normal and abnormal, to other medical staff in the absence of off-site consultants.

Ensure reports are sent out in a timely manner to all relevant parties, in accordance with local policies/departmental protocols.

Ensure the technical quality of assessment complies with published national guidelines.

Maintain and expand competencies to remain state registered.

Responsible for CPD and achieving goals set in IPR appraisal plus ensuring mandatory training is up to date.

Perform clerical duties and assist Lead Physiologist in day-to-day running of department and managing service provision.

Partake in training of students/other medical/non-medical staff as required.
